Output 8d30a4f393fd8d6446c0c96b5f7d20a4db7ccce5dae377f9acb915d9e117e2f3:0

value
20243766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c44e68cd458dfa53ccaad7e5f1fbf4c0f80b8207 OP_EQUAL
address
3KazJ82KwAa3hUEyHvmppru9hUqYEBzBxg
transaction
8d30a4f393fd8d6446c0c96b5f7d20a4db7ccce5dae377f9acb915d9e117e2f3
spent
true